CFFN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review

151 of the 3,752 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Capitol Federal Financial (CFFN)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$1.33B — down 2.3% from $1.36B a quarter earlier.

Fund positioning in CFFN was balanced in Q1 2015: 11 funds opened new positions, 11 closed out, 57 added to existing stakes and 52 trimmed.

The largest buyer was American Century Companies, adding an estimated $14.1M. The largest seller was DePrince Race & Zollo Inc (DRZ), cutting an estimated $8.58M.
